# Deploying the APIs (Flux GitOps → Talos)
|
||||
|
||||
> Handoff doc. The APIs are **not** deployed by Gitea Actions — they are deployed
|
||||
> by **Flux** running on the Talos Kubernetes cluster. The Gitea Actions in this
|
||||
> repo only build the docs-site image, validate Flux manifests, and publish
|
||||
> OpenAPI specs to RapidAPI.
|
||||
|
||||
## How a deploy actually happens
|
||||
|
||||
```
|
||||
API repo (e.g. leeworks-agents/zip-enrichment)
|
||||
└─ its own CI builds & pushes registry.leeworks.dev/zip-enrichment/server:<tag>
|
||||
└─ Flux image-automation (flux/image-automation/) rewrites the
|
||||
{"$imagepolicy": "flux-system:<api>"} marker in flux/<api>/helmrelease.yaml
|
||||
└─ Flux GitRepository "api-company" (polls main every 5m)
|
||||
└─ HelmRelease per API (flux/<api>/helmrelease.yaml, bedag/raw chart)
|
||||
└─ Deployment rolls out in the cluster namespace
|
||||
```

## Prerequisite: the manifests must be live in the cluster's Flux source
|
||||
|
||||
`flux/api-company-source/gitrepository.yaml` is **reference only**. The
|
||||
*authoritative* copy must be committed to **`0xWheatyz/Talos`** at:
|
||||
|
||||
```
|
||||
testing1/first-cluster/cluster/flux/api-company/
|
||||
```
|
||||
|
||||
If that path does not point Flux at this repo's `flux/` directory, Flux never
|
||||
sees these HelmReleases and nothing deploys. Verify the Talos repo references
|
||||
this repo's `main` branch and that a Flux `Kustomization` includes the
|
||||
`api-company` path.
|
||||
|
||||
Per-API the cluster also needs (already templated under `flux/<api>/`):
|
||||
- `namespace.yaml` — the target namespace
|
||||
- the `gitea-registry` imagePullSecret in that namespace
|
||||
- `externalsecret.yaml` — pulls API keys (e.g. RapidAPI) via external-secrets
|
||||
- `servicemonitor.yaml` — Prometheus scraping (optional for deploy)

## Deploy / sync all APIs
|
||||
|
||||
```bash
|
||||
export KUBECONFIG=~/.kube/talos-leeworks
|
||||
|
||||
# 1. Pull the latest main into the cluster's Git source
|
||||
flux reconcile source git api-company -n flux-system
|
||||
|
||||
# 2. Apply the manifests (name may differ — check: flux get kustomizations -A)
|
||||
flux reconcile kustomization api-company -n flux-system
|
||||
|
||||
# 3. Reconcile each API's HelmRelease
|
||||
flux reconcile helmrelease zip-enrichment -n zip-enrichment
|
||||
flux reconcile helmrelease holidays -n holidays
|
||||
flux reconcile helmrelease air-quality -n air-quality
|
||||
flux reconcile helmrelease vin-decoder -n vin-decoder
|
||||
|
||||
# 4. Verify everything is Ready
|
||||
flux get helmreleases -A
|
||||
kubectl get pods -A | grep -E 'zip-enrichment|holidays|air-quality|vin-decoder'
|
||||
```
|
||||
|
||||
## Troubleshooting
|
||||
|
||||
```bash
|
||||
# Why is a release not Ready?
|
||||
flux get helmrelease <name> -n <ns>
|
||||
kubectl describe helmrelease <name> -n <ns>
|
||||
|
||||
# Is image automation picking up new tags?
|
||||
flux get image policy -n flux-system
|
||||
flux get image update -A
|
||||
|
||||
# Pod won't start (image pull / secret issues)
|
||||
kubectl describe pod <pod> -n <ns>
|
||||
kubectl get events -n <ns> --sort-by=.lastTimestamp | tail -20
|
||||
```
|
||||
|
||||
## Force a fresh deploy of a single API
|
||||
|
||||
```bash
|
||||
flux suspend helmrelease <name> -n <ns>
|
||||
flux resume helmrelease <name> -n <ns> # triggers a fresh reconcile
|
||||
# or restart the workload directly:
|
||||
kubectl rollout restart deployment/<name> -n <ns>
|
||||
```
